Jon Bryant is an artist whose international popularity is growing, leaving a lasting impression on fans by virtue of his haunting ambient dream-folk singer/songwriter roots. From Fall River, Nova Scotia, his first single Deaf was selected the iTunes single-of-the-week, and the attendant album was featured as well. Bryant followed up that initial online success with What Takes You in 2012, resulting in numerous TV sync placements while he toured throughout North America and Europe.

In 2016 Jon released the highly anticipated Twenty Something featuring the production of Alex Newport (Bloc Party, Death Cab for Cutie, Mars Volta and City and Colour), Nygel Asselin (Half Moon Run), Jordan Wiberg and Rick Parker (Lord Huron, Black Rebel Motorcycle Club). Not only does his unique Jeff Buckley-esque vocals and compelling songwriting command attention, his riveting live shows seal the deal.

Jon releases a new album – Cult Classic – in early 2019.
